Version 1

The first version of Ivor was made for a remake of "The Railway" (Episode 1), inspired by Callum Walker (SI3DFilms)'s Trainz one. However, he was only a one-off, so I made sure to make him 90% reversible. I repainted Stepney's shell and mounted it on a Percy chassis, albeit with Stepney's siderods. While painting the shell, I tried to get a colour mixture similar enough to Percy's so it could match Percy's wheels. This is what it looked like:

Version 2

This version was made from a 2012 TrackMaster Thomas that was bought in the UK. The sides of the footplate had to be trimmed in order to make room for the side panels, and the front bufferbeam was cut off and replaced with the rear bufferbeam from an old TOMY/HiT Thomas. The fake middle wheels were also cut off, with their remains being hidden using electrical tape.
